In a recent study conducted by experts in the field, it has been revealed that the demand for online shopping in India has seen a significant surge in recent years. The convenience and ease of shopping from the comfort of one’s home have contributed to this rise in popularity. With the increasing use of smartphones and the internet, more and more people are turning to online platforms to make their purchases. This trend has been further accelerated by the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ic, which has led to restrictions on physical shopping in many parts of the country. As a result, e-commerce websites and apps have witnessed a boom in traffic and sales. The study also highlights that the most popular categories for online shopping in India include electronics, clothing, and groceries. Companies in the e-commerce sector are constantly innovating to provide a seamless shopping experience for customers, with features such as one-click ordering and fast delivery. With the festive season approaching, experts predict that online shopping in India will continue to see a steady growth. As more and more people experience the convenience and benefits of online shopping, the trend is expected to become even more entrenched in the Indian retail landscape. This shift towards e-commerce is not only changing the way people shop but also presenting new opportunities for businesses to reach a wider audience.
